Story summary
- The Welsh government has approved a £26 billion budget aimed at bolstering public services, with Liberal Democrat Jane Dodds lending her support. While the budget allocates funds for the NHS and childcare, opposition parties are voicing concerns that it overlooks pressing economic issues. Labour's Mark Drakeford calls for greater investment, highlighting the urgent needs of Wales.
